12. Network Settings
12.1 Configuring the General Settings
Network settings must be properly configured before you operate DVR over network.
Step
1
Go to
Menu > Configuration > Network > General
.
Network Settings Interface
Step
2
On the
General Settings
interface, you can configure the following parameters:
Working Mode (applicable for GD-RT-AT5016N), NIC Type, IPv4 Address, IPv4
Gateway, MTU, DNS Server and Main NIC.
Working Mode
There are two 10M/100M/1000M NIC cards provided by GD-RT-AT5016N, and it
allows the device to work in Multi-address and Net-fault Tolerance.
Multi-address Mode:
The parameters of the two NIC cards can be configured
independently. You can select LAN1 or LAN2 in the NIC type field for parameter
settings.
You can select one NIC card as default route. And then the system is connecting
with the extranet and the data will be forwarded through the default route.
Net-fault Tolerance Mode:
The two NIC cards use the same IP address, and you
can select the Main NIC to LAN1 or LAN2. By this way, in case of one NIC card
failure, the device will automatically enable the other standby NIC card so as to
ensure the normal running of the whole system.
